What do I need to make chopped cheese?
Hoagie rolls – Feel free to use hamburger or hot dog buns instead of the hoagie rolls.
Onion –cut in half and not too thinly sliced so they hold up when cooking.
Bell pepper -choose your favorite color or mix them together and slice them the same size as the onion.
Olive oil -you can use your favorite cooking oil, but I love the flavor my extra virgin olive oil adds to the veggies.
Ground beef -I like to use beef that has some fat in it, so the sandwich is nice and juicy; at least 15% is good.
Salt & freshly cracked black pepper -this helps bring everything to life.
Garlic powder -the perfect addition to salt and pepper for beef.
Ground coriander -adds a little bit of sweetness with a hint of citrus to the beef.
Cheese -American, cheddar, muenster, mozzarella, or your favorite melty cheeses.
What’s in the sauce?
Mayonnaise -use your favorite mayo to create this simple sauce.
Sriracha sauce -adds a tangy, sweet, and spicy kick to the mayo.
What can I put out for toppings?
Everyone may like it a little differently, but some great options would be ketchup, lettuce, tomatoes, fresh onions, pickled jalapeños, pickles, and sliced avocado.
How do I make the sauce?
Whisk together some mayo with sriracha to taste in a bowl.
How do I cook the veggies?
Heat a cast-iron skillet over medium heat and add the onion and pepper slices, two tablespoons of olive oil, and a pinch of salt. Cook until softened, then transfer to a plate or bowl.
How do I melt the cheese into the beef?
Add the ground beef to the skillet and flatten it out. Then, season with salt, pepper, garlic powder, and coriander. Cook over medium-high heat for about 4 minutes. Flip it over and season with salt. Break the beef up and cook for 2 minutes. Top with lots of cheese and cook until it melts.
How do I put the sandwiches together?
Toast the buns and slice them in half, lengthwise. Add sauce and some ketchup. Top with lettuce, the onion and bell pepper mixture, and some jalapenos. Top with the chopped cheese meat and any additional toppings your family loves, and serve. Kali Orexi!

Ingredients
- 4 hoagie rolls
- 1 onion, cut in half and thinly sliced
- 1 bell pepper, sliced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 and 1/2 lbs ground beef
- 1 teaspoon salt, to taste
- freshly cracked black pepper to taste
- garlic powder
- ground coriander
- cheese: American, cheddar, muenster, or mozzarella
the toppings:
- lettuce
- pickled jalapeños
- tomatoes
- onions
- avocado
- ketchup
For the sauce:
- 1/2 cup mayonnaise
- sriracha sauce
Instructions
Mae the Sauce: Combine some mayo with sriracha (to taste) in a bowl and whisk together.
Heat a cast-iron sillet over medium heat and add the onions and pepper with 2 tablespoons of olive oil and a pinch of salt. Cook until softened and transfer to a plate/bowl.
Add the ground beef to the skillet and flatten it out. season with salt, pepper, garlic powder, and coriander. Cook over medium-high heat for about 4 minutes. Flip it over and season with salt. Break the beef up and cook for 2 minutes. Top with lots of cheese and cook until it melts.
Toast the buns and slice them in half, lengthwise. Add sauce and some ketchup. Top with lettuce, the onion and bell pepper mixture, and some jalpenos. Top with the chopped cheese meat and serve.
Notes
Feel free to use hamburger or hot dog buns instead of the hoagie rolls.
